WellHeater Reviews and Complaints WellHeater models typically advertise power outputs in a range from about 400W–500W up to a maximum around 800W depending on the variant and regional version, and those wattage figures make WellHeater a lower-consumption alternative to many full-size portable heaters, which often operate at 1500W or higher. Noise performance is another listed spec: WellHeater is promoted as operating quietly, generally under 45 dB and sometimes closer to 30 dB, which positions WellHeater as suitable for bedrooms and offices where low noise matters. Other functional features flagged in product literature include a timer function that typically ranges from 1 to 12 hours, a built-in fan for heat distribution, and safety features such as overheat protection, automatic shut-off, and a cool-touch housing; some promotional pieces additionally cite tip-over protection and an antimicrobial air filter on certain models, though the latter is framed as a claim on some product variants rather than a universal specification.
